Gangetic dolphin meat sold openly in Dibrugarh, Assam

Recently, a fish seller was found selling dolphin meat at a roadside market of Lezai-Kalakhowa, 15 km from Dibrugarh. A local woman clicked the photograph of the person selling meat and informed wildlife activists. Following a hue and cry raised by environmental groups, police registered a case and initiated an enquiry. However, the culprits are yet to be arrested.
